A Guide to Scalable Warehousing
Growth often exposes warehouse weaknesses before it creates visible wins. One successful product launch, one new retail contract, or one seasonal spike can turn a workable operation into a source of missed despatches, stock errors and rising costs. That is why a guide to scalable warehousing matters for any business that wants to grow without losing control of service, stock or margin.
Scalable warehousing is not simply about taking more pallet space when volumes rise. It is about building a warehouse model that can absorb change without causing disruption across the wider supply chain. For growing retailers, courier networks and fulfilment-led businesses, that means storage, labour, systems and transport must all be able to adjust at pace.
What scalable warehousing actually means
A scalable warehouse operation can expand or contract in line with demand while maintaining accuracy, speed and visibility. The key point is consistency. If volume doubles but order accuracy drops, the operation is bigger but not truly scalable.
In practice, scalability depends on how well the warehouse handles four pressures at once: changing stock levels, changing order profiles, changing delivery expectations and changing operating costs. A business shipping pallet quantities to trade customers has different requirements from one sending hundreds of single-item ecommerce orders each day. Both can scale, but not in the same way.
This is where many businesses get caught out. They plan for space, but not for process. They add racking, but not better stock control. They increase despatch targets, but not pick routes, staffing cover or carrier coordination. A warehouse becomes scalable when capacity planning and operational discipline work together.
A guide to scalable warehousing starts with demand patterns
The first step is understanding what growth really looks like in your operation. Average monthly order volume is useful, but it rarely tells the full story. Warehouse pressure usually comes from volatility, not averages.
A business might have stable annual turnover but severe peaks around promotions, product launches or Christmas trading. Another may hold stock for slow-moving lines while a small number of fast sellers create most of the daily pick activity. If those patterns are not mapped properly, warehouse decisions become reactive.
Good scalability planning starts with a close view of order frequency, SKU range, pallet movement, returns volume and cut-off times. It should also include how demand changes by customer type. Wholesale fulfilment, marketplace orders and direct-to-consumer deliveries create different handling requirements, even when they draw from the same stock holding.
Once these patterns are clear, warehousing can be designed around realistic pressure points rather than broad assumptions.
Space matters, but layout matters more
When businesses think about scaling, they often focus on square footage. Capacity is important, but poor layout can waste available space and slow down the whole operation.
A well-planned warehouse uses space according to stock behaviour, not convenience. Fast-moving products should sit in locations that reduce travel time and speed up picking. Bulk storage should support replenishment without interfering with despatch activity. Returns, quarantine stock and packing areas need clear separation so that exceptions do not interrupt core workflows.
There is also a trade-off to manage. High-density storage can improve space utilisation, but it may reduce access speed if stock needs frequent picking. The right setup depends on whether the operation is pallet-led, case-led or item-led. A scalable model balances storage efficiency with flow.

Systems are central to scalable warehouse control
Manual processes can work for a small operation, but they become a risk when volumes increase. Once order numbers rise, stock control errors multiply quickly and visibility starts to fall away.
A warehouse management system helps maintain control across goods-in, putaway, stock location, picking, packing and despatch. It reduces reliance on memory and paper-based checking, which is vital when more staff, more SKUs and more movement enter the picture.
That said, technology only works if the process behind it is sound. A poor layout or unclear goods-in procedure will still create problems, even with good software in place. Scalable warehousing depends on clean operational rules: where stock goes, how it is checked, when it is replenished and how exceptions are handled.
For decision-makers, visibility is just as important as internal accuracy. Reliable reporting on stock levels, order status and capacity gives businesses the confidence to plan promotions, allocate inventory and respond to customer demand without guesswork.
Labour flexibility is just as important as storage capacity
Warehouses do not scale through space and systems alone. Labour planning is often the difference between a smooth peak period and a costly bottleneck.
As order profiles change, staffing requirements change with them. A rise in pallet-in and pallet-out activity needs a different labour mix from a rise in ecommerce picking and packing. Some periods require more receiving support, while others put pressure on despatch windows and carrier handovers.
This is why scalable warehousing needs flexible workforce planning. Cross-trained teams, clear shift structures and dependable operational management help maintain continuity when demand changes quickly. It also reduces dependence on a small number of key individuals, which is a common weakness in growing warehouse operations.
There is a cost balance to consider. Carrying too much permanent labour can damage efficiency in quieter periods, but under-resourcing during peak demand can harm service levels and customer retention. The right model often includes a core stable team supported by flexible capacity when required.
Transport integration keeps warehousing scalable
A warehouse does not operate in isolation. It is only scalable if outbound distribution can keep pace with fulfilment activity.
This point is often missed. Businesses improve warehouse throughput, then find their carrier setup cannot support later cut-off times, higher daily parcel counts or more complex delivery requirements. The result is congestion at despatch, delayed collections or avoidable next-day failures.
Scalable warehousing works best when transport and fulfilment planning are aligned. Collection windows, route planning, carrier allocation and last-mile delivery capacity all affect warehouse performance. Cost control should improve as you scale, not drift
Growth can create higher revenue while quietly eroding margin. Warehousing is one of the areas where this happens most often.
Costs rise when businesses pay for space they do not fully use, carry excess stock, overstaff around poor processes or spend time correcting avoidable errors. A scalable operation should improve cost predictability, not reduce it.
The best approach is to track the metrics that genuinely reflect warehouse health: cost per order, pick accuracy, stock accuracy, dwell time, turnaround time and labour productivity. These figures show whether added capacity is producing better performance or simply covering deeper inefficiencies.
It also helps to separate fixed and variable costs clearly. Some businesses are better served by dedicated warehouse space and long-term operational control. Others benefit more from a flexible model that grows with demand and limits overhead exposure. It depends on stock profile, order volatility and how quickly the business expects to expand.
Choosing the right guide to scalable warehousing for your business
There is no single warehouse model that suits every business. A courier operator with high-volume daily movement needs speed, staging discipline and dependable despatch coordination. An ecommerce brand needs strong inventory visibility, accurate pick-and-pack processes and the ability to handle seasonal peaks without service failure.
What matters is choosing a setup that supports present demand while giving you room to adapt.
